A油田水驱特征曲线选型

Determination of the type of water-drive characteristic curve of A oilfield

摘要 注水开发的油田中,利用水驱特征曲线进行注水开发效果评价是常用的油藏工程方法,优选符合油田实际情况的水驱特征曲线类型就很有必要。绘制利用甲型、乙型、丙型和丁型水驱特征曲线预测的累计产油量及含水率曲线,并分别与实际累计产油量及含水率曲线进行历史拟合,可以优选出适合的水驱特征曲线类型。通过在A油田的实际应用表明,(1)采用拟合法优选的水驱特征曲线类型符合A油田开发特征;(2)明确了A油田的水驱特征曲线类型为丁型,评估了剩余可采储量,为合理评价油田阶段注水开发效果及编制后期开发调整方案奠定了基础。 It is a common reservoir engineering method to evaluate the effect of water-flooding development by using water-drive characteristic curve in the oilfield,so it is necessary to select the type of water-drive characteristic curve that conforms to the actual situation of oilfield.By drawing the cumulative oil production and water-cut curve predicted by using A,B,C and D type water-drive characteristic curve,and by matching with the actual cumulative oil production and water-cut curve respectively,the suitable type of water-drive characteristic curve can be optimized.Through the practical application in the A oilfield,it shows that,(1)the type of water-drive characteristic curve optimized by fitting method is consistent with the development characteristics of the A oilfield.(2)It is clear that the type of water-drive characteristic curve of the A oilfield is D-type,and the remaining recoverable reserves are evaluated,which lays a foundation for reasonably evaluating the effect of water injection development and compiling the later development adjustment scheme.
